Bind C-u, C-b & C-f less aggressively #1975
This commit is contained in:
parent
74d87a1e24
commit
ba7b8d661d
1 changed files with 9 additions and 6 deletions
|
@ -3,11 +3,11 @@
|
||||||
(when (featurep! :editor evil +everywhere)
|
(when (featurep! :editor evil +everywhere)
|
||||||
;; Have C-u behave similarly to `doom/backward-to-bol-or-indent'.
|
;; Have C-u behave similarly to `doom/backward-to-bol-or-indent'.
|
||||||
;; NOTE SPC u replaces C-u as the universal argument.
|
;; NOTE SPC u replaces C-u as the universal argument.
|
||||||
(map! :gi "C-u" #'doom/backward-kill-to-bol-and-indent
|
(map! :i "C-u" #'doom/backward-kill-to-bol-and-indent
|
||||||
:gi "C-w" #'backward-kill-word
|
:i "C-w" #'backward-kill-word
|
||||||
;; Vimmish ex motion keys
|
;; Vimmish ex motion keys
|
||||||
:gi "C-b" #'backward-word
|
:i "C-b" #'backward-word
|
||||||
:gi "C-f" #'forward-word)
|
:i "C-f" #'forward-word)
|
||||||
|
|
||||||
;; Minibuffer
|
;; Minibuffer
|
||||||
(define-key! evil-ex-completion-map
|
(define-key! evil-ex-completion-map
|
||||||
|
@ -19,11 +19,14 @@
|
||||||
|
|
||||||
(define-key! :keymaps +default-minibuffer-maps
|
(define-key! :keymaps +default-minibuffer-maps
|
||||||
[escape] #'abort-recursive-edit
|
[escape] #'abort-recursive-edit
|
||||||
"C-v" #'yank
|
|
||||||
"C-z" (λ! (ignore-errors (call-interactively #'undo)))
|
|
||||||
"C-a" #'move-beginning-of-line
|
"C-a" #'move-beginning-of-line
|
||||||
"C-b" #'backward-word
|
"C-b" #'backward-word
|
||||||
|
"C-f" #'forward-word
|
||||||
"C-r" #'evil-paste-from-register
|
"C-r" #'evil-paste-from-register
|
||||||
|
"C-u" #'doom/backward-kill-to-bol-and-indent
|
||||||
|
"C-v" #'yank
|
||||||
|
"C-w" #'backward-kill-word
|
||||||
|
"C-z" (λ! (ignore-errors (call-interactively #'undo)))
|
||||||
;; Scrolling lines
|
;; Scrolling lines
|
||||||
"C-j" #'next-line
|
"C-j" #'next-line
|
||||||
"C-k" #'previous-line
|
"C-k" #'previous-line
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ue